Concurrent Continues to Hit Growth Projections, Adds Three New Advisors at the start of 2024


Concurrent Investment Advisors, LLC ("Concurrent"), a leading multi-custodial, hybrid registered investment adviser ("RIA"), continues to meet its growth projections, attracting three new advisors to its platform from Wells Fargo and Raymond James. Ramin Abrams, Sean O'Neill, and Glenn Holmes, collectively contribute $365 million in new assets under management to Concurrent's $7.5 billion AUM with offices in New York, Florida, and Colorado.

Ramin Abrams and Glenn Holmes aligned with Concurrent to position their firms for continued growth while tapping into the platform's multi-custodial offerings, modern technology, and operational support team. Both advisors are launching new offices, with Holmes' T7 Legacy focusing on strategic financial planning for corporate executives and business owners in the Southeast and Abrams adopting the Concurrent Advisors brand in New York to offer wealth and investment management, financial planning, and multi-family generational planning.

In addition to building their flagship businesses under Concurrent's wing, advisors can also join existing Concurrent partner firms. Sean O'Neill has joined Legacy Wealth Partners, a Denver-based firm already well established in the Concurrent network. O'Neill serves pre-retirees, retirees, and their families. Joining Concurrent will give his clients access to improved services with a fiduciary focus. O'Neill was drawn to the ability to maintain his independence, having departed Raymond James Financial Services, and Concurrent's track record of successful transitions, wider array of investment solutions, and a collaborative compliance department allowing him to expand his marketing efforts.

About Concurrent
Concurrent is a multi-custodial, hybrid registered investment adviser (RIA) created to give independent advisors all the resources they need to grow their businesses and adapt to the evolving financial needs of their clients. Headquartered in Tampa, Florida, Concurrent was established in 2017 by former advisors, business owners and industry leaders to cultivate a national network of independent providers of unbiased, fiduciary advice.

Through a partnership with Merchant, Concurrent offers its advisors strategic resources, full operational support, and opportunities to align through shared equity and mutual success. Independence and collaboration are central to Concurrent's ethos, as advisors maintain their autonomy and unique value while sharing best practices and best-in-breed technology to grow as entrepreneurs.
